2021 PORSCHE CAYENNE Recalled by Porsche Cars North America, Inc. — SUSPENSION:REAR

Dealers will inspect the rear axle, adjust the alignment as necessary, and replace any prematurely or unevenly worn tires,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ed March 10, 2022. Owners may contact Porsche customer service at 1-800-767-7243. Porsche's number for this recall is ANA1.
Affected Products
2021 PORSCHE CAYENNE. Porsche Cars North America, Inc. (Porsche) is recalling certain 2021-2022 Cayenne vehicles. The rear axle alignment may not have been inspected after the repairs for Recall 21V-271 (AMA9) were performed.
Why Was This Recalled?
Rear axle misalignment may cause premature or uneven tire wear, increasing the risk of a crash.
Where Was This Sold?
Nationwide
